Abstract

The invention discloses a forming method of a balloon. According to the method, a pipe for making a balloon is divided into three parts: a middle part, tapered parts adjacent to two ends, and end parts of the two ends. The three parts are subjected to heating and tension, respectively, to obtain a balloon with uniform thickness. Through cooperation of separate heating with a reasonable tensile speed, the balloon made through the forming method is uniform in thickness, good in flexibility and easy to fold. The ability for passing through lesion blood vessels is improved, the size of the whole balloon is decreased, and the balloon is convenient for packaging and transportation.

Technical field
The present invention relates to the preparation method of a kind of medical balloon, in particular to a kind of sacculus forming method.
Background technology
The moulding process that at present manufacturing enterprise of medical balloon is used is all the process conditions of stretch-blow in mould, i.e. Intermediate coat heats, the mould of end closing mould stretching, as disclosed in existing Chinese patent application one: high pressure resistant sacculus molding technology, Shen Please number 200910067937.X, the sacculus mid portion thickness so formed out is uniform, but begins to gradually from sacculus tapering Thickening and hardness becomes big, after the sacculus of such molding makes product, can face many deficiencies in the folding process of sacculus, as Sacculus tapering after folding is harder, and sacculus Fold Flap is the most adherent, and this can cause the bigger than normal of whole sacculus product external diameter, is using During will be declined by the ability in vascular lesion region, be substantially reduced its usability.
Summary of the invention
Present invention aim to the defect overcoming existing medical balloon end harder, it is provided that a kind of simple ball Capsule forming method, to produce all uniform medical balloon of various piece thickness.
For achieving the above object, the sacculus forming method designed by the present invention, its step is as follows:
1) tubing for making sacculus is prepared;
2) being closed tubing one end, the other end is filled with gases at high pressure;
3) heating tubing entirety, tubing forms a bullet after heating in the deflated condition, and it comprises centre Partly, near the tapering at two ends, the end at two ends, three parts;Then with the two ends of tubing as impetus, carry out drawing for the first time Stretch, make the mid portion of bullet reach the thickness being pre-designed;
4) mid portion making stretching complete is cooled to room temperature, and the tapering and two at the close two ends of bullet of simultaneously heating The end of end, then with the two ends of tubing as impetus, carries out second time and stretches, make the tapering of tubing reach the thickness being pre-designed Degree;
5) tapering making stretching complete is cooled to room temperature, and the end at bullet two ends of simultaneously heating, then with tubing Two ends are impetus, carry out third time and stretch, make the end of tubing reach the thickness being pre-designed, obtain ball after cooling and shaping Capsule.
Such scheme, described step 3) in temperature that tubing entirety is heated be 120~220 DEG C.
Such scheme, described step 3) in stretching for the first time time, in tubing, gas pressure is 5~50atm.
Such scheme, described step 4) in the heat temperature of end at the tapering at close two ends of bullet and two ends be 150~250 DEG C.
Such scheme, described step 5) in the heat temperature of end at bullet two ends be 150~250 DEG C.
Such scheme, described step 3), 4), 5) in, draw speed during stretching is 1~20mm/s.
Beneficial effects of the present invention: matched with rational draw speed by Segmented heating, makes the inventive method institute The sacculus thickness of preparation is homogeneous, and flexibility is good, it is easy to fold, and the ability being not only passed to lesion region blood vessel strengthens, and contracting The little product size of whole sacculus, more conducively packed and transported.

Detailed description of the invention
Below in conjunction with the drawings and specific embodiments, the present invention is described in further detail.
As it is shown in figure 1, the preparation-obtained sacculus of sacculus forming method is uniform to mid portion thickness from end, the method Step is as follows:
1) tubing for making sacculus is prepared;
2) being inserted by tubing in sacculus mould, one end is closed, and the other end is filled with gases at high pressure;
3) heating sacculus mould entirety, gas pressure is set to 5~50atm, temperature is 120~220 DEG C, tubing forms a bullet after at high temperature softening and being affixed on sacculus mould inwall under gas high pressure effect, it Comprise mid portion 1, the close tapering 2 at two ends, the end 3 at two ends, three parts;Described sacculus mould includes middle heating Mould (not shown), tapering heating mould (not shown), end heat mould (not shown), these three mould is individually present, its Interior shape is respectively cooperating with the mid portion 1 of bullet, near the tapering 2 at two ends, the end 3 at two ends;After temperature stabilization, right Tubing carries out stretching for the first time, and the speed with 1~20mm/s stretches the two ends of tubing simultaneously, makes the mid portion 1 of tubing reach The thickness being pre-designed, keeps 10~30s after having stretched;
4) make middle heating mould be cooled to room temperature, while centre heating mould cooling, tapering is heated mould and end Portion's heating mould is warming up to 150~250 DEG C, after temperature stabilization, tubing carries out second time and stretches, with the speed of 1~20mm/s Degree stretches the two ends of tubing simultaneously, makes the tapering 2 of tubing reach the thickness being pre-designed, and keeps 10~30s after having stretched;
5) making tapering heating mould be cooled to room temperature, during tapering heating mould cooling, (in like manner step 3, tapering keeps not Become), end heat mould is warming up to 150~250 DEG C simultaneously, after temperature stabilization, tubing carries out third time and stretches, with 1~ The speed of 20mm/s stretches the two ends of tubing simultaneously, makes the end 3 of tubing reach the thickness being pre-designed, and keeps after having stretched 10~30s, end heat mould is cooled to room temperature, opens mould, obtains the sacculus that each several part thickness is homogeneous.
After testing, the sacculus thickness prepared by said method is homogeneous, and flexibility is good, it is easy to fold.
